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C) and grease a 9-inch round cake pan.
In a large mixing bowl, cream together the softened butter and granulated sugar until light and fluffy.
Add the eggs, one at a time, mixing well after each addition. Stir in the vanilla extract.
In a separate bowl, whisk together the all-purpose flour, baking powder, and salt.
Gradually add the dry ingredients to the wet mixture, alternating with the milk, starting and ending with the flour mixture. Mix until just combined.
Pour the batter into the prepared cake pan and smooth the top with a spatula.
Bake in the preheated oven for 25-30 minutes or until a toothpick inserted into the center comes out clean.
Allow the cake to cool in the pan for 10 minutes before transferring it to a wire rack to cool completely.
While the cake is cooling, prepare the frosting by beating together the softened butter and powdered sugar until well combined.
Add the milk and vanilla extract to the frosting and mix until smooth and creamy.
Once the cake is completely cool, spread the white frosting evenly on top. Decorate with cherry pie filling, placing cherries in the center or scattered evenly over the frosting.
Slice the cake and serve each piece on a red plate for a festive touch.
